Wetheral is a distinguished village in Cumbria, situated just east of Carlisle along the scenic River Eden valley. The area features an attractive mix of Victorian terraces, period cottages, and modern family homes, many occupied by commuters who appreciate the village's peaceful rural setting with excellent transport links. This historic settlement, known for its priory ruins and railway viaduct, maintains a strong community spirit while offering easy access to both Carlisle city centre and the broader Eden Valley.
